Finding Email Drafts

If you use the Samsung Email app or Gmail app, finding draft emails is quite straightforward.

Samsung Email App

  1. Open the Samsung Email App: Locate the app on your home screen or in your app drawer.
  2. Navigate to the Drafts Folder: On the main screen, you will see a list of your email folders (like Inbox, Sent, etc.).
  3. Select Drafts: Tap on the “Drafts” folder. Here, you will see all the emails you have saved as drafts.

Gmail App

  1. Open the Gmail App: Tap on the Gmail icon on your phone.
  2. Access the Menu: In the top left corner, tap on the three horizontal lines (hamburger menu).
  3. Choose Drafts: Scroll down and look for the “Drafts” option in the list. Selecting this will show you all your draft emails.

Locating Drafts in Messages

Drafts in the Messages app can often be overlooked. However, if you accidentally exit while composing a text message, don’t worry.

  1. Open Messages App: Tap on the Messages app to launch it.
  2. Find Drafts: Look for a tab labeled “Drafts” or check the conversation list for a message that indicates it’s a draft.

If you see a message that you previously typed but didn’t send, selecting it will allow you to continue editing.

Using Samsung Cloud

Samsung Cloud allows you to sync your drafts between your phone, tablet, and even Samsung’s web platform. To ensure your drafts are backed up:

  1. Open Settings: Go to the settings app on your Samsung device.
  2. Select Accounts and Backup: Choose this option from the menu.
  3. Tap on Samsung Cloud: Here, you can check what is currently being backed up.
  4. Enable Notes Sync: Ensure that “Notes” and “Email” options are enabled in the backup settings.

By doing this, you can access your drafts from any synced device, making it a great way to ensure you never lose your work again.

Troubleshooting Common Issues

Despite the straightforward process of locating your drafts, problems might arise. Here are some common issues and how to troubleshoot them.

Draft Not Saving

If you notice that your drafts are not saving, check the following:

  • App Settings: Make sure that the auto-save feature is turned on in the app settings.
  • Storage Space: Insufficient storage may prevent drafts from being saved. Check your device storage and consider freeing up space if necessary.

Drafts Disappearing

If your drafts suddenly seem to have vanished, try these steps:

  1. Check Other Folders: Sometimes drafts may inadvertently end up in another folder. For instance, check Spam or Other folders in your email apps.
  2. Restart the App: Close and reopen the app to refresh its data. In some cases, this simple action can restore visibility of your drafts.
  3. Software Updates: Ensure that your operating system and applications are up to date. Outdated software can lead to bugs, including disappearing drafts.

Is there a specific folder for drafts in Samsung Email?

Yes, in the Samsung Email app, there is a specific folder for drafts. To access it, launch the Email app and navigate to the menu. Look for the “Folders” option, and within that section, you should find “Drafts.” This folder stores all your unsent emails or emails under construction.

Once you’re in the Drafts folder, you can easily view, edit, or send any draft emails you have saved. It’s a straightforward way to manage your uncompleted messages without having to sift through your entire inbox.

Can I recover deleted draft messages in the Samsung Messages app?

Recovering deleted draft messages in the Samsung Messages app can be challenging, as drafts are typically not saved once deleted. If you accidentally delete your draft, there is no built-in recovery option for recovering those specific unsaved messages unless you have a backup of your messages on Samsung Cloud or another service.

To prevent this issue in the future, regularly back up your messages or use a third-party app that allows you to save drafts more reliably. This will help you maintain access to your vital communication drafts and reduce the chances of data loss.
